    Abstract: A mechanism for communicating messages, each including a command and a response, in a network having central processing complexes (CPCs) and one or more coupling facilities. Each coupling facility has a central processor for executing instructions and a main storage. Messages are sent from a message control block in the main storage of the CPC sending the message, and the response to the message is received in a message response block of the CPC without an interrupt to the program being executed by the central processor of the CPC. Each message from a CPC to the coupling facility may include a command and an indicator bit which instructs the coupling facility to execute the command either in synchronism with or asynchronously to the execution of the sending processor. The coupling facility executes the command and returns a response which is received in a message response block of the main storage of the sending CPC without an interrupt to any program being executed by the central processor of that CPC.

    Abstract: A virtual lookaside facility is provided for maintaining named data objects in class-related data spaces in virtual storage, readily retrievable by user programs. A search order is associated with each user, specifying an ordered list of "major named" which are, in effect, sequentially searched for a specified "minor name", or data object, to obtain a virtual storage copy of that data object. As data objects are placed into a virtual cache, existence information, implicit in the naming structure, is captured and saved. This information is relied on later in retrieving objects from the cache. The data isolation provided by maintaining class data and control blocks in individual data spaces is exploited to prevent failures relating to one class of objects from affecting the others, and to handle latent program users, following failures, effectively. An LRU-like trimming technique is used to remove less useful objects from the cache when cache space is fully utilized.
